webassembly v0.5.0

Modules summary

WebAssembly

Wrapper module for assembling html elements from blocks into iolist

WebAssembly.Builder

Provide context for using the elements DSL (WebAssembly.DSL) and possibly HTML macros (WebAssembly.HTML module)

WebAssembly.DSL

Basic DSL for assembling HTML elements from blocks

WebAssembly.HTML

HTML5 wrapper macros to be used inside WebAssembly.Builder

WebAssembly.Tools

Tools manipulating assembly input & output

WebAssembly.Tools.Input
WebAssembly.Tools.Output
WebAssembly.Types

Types of input, intermediate and output data used in the elements assembly